    public AudioFileFormat getAudioFileFormat(InputStream inputStream, long mediaLength) throws UnsupportedAudioFileException, IOException
    {
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out(">MpegAudioFileReader.getAudioFileFormat(InputStream inputStream, long mediaLength): begin");
        HashMap aff_properties = new HashMap();
        HashMap af_properties = new HashMap();
        int mLength = (int) mediaLength;
        int size = inputStream.available();
        PushbackInputStream pis = new PushbackInputStream(inputStream, MARK_LIMIT);
        byte head[] = new byte[22];
        pis.read(head);
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ader)
        {
            TDebug.out("InputStream : " + inputStream + " =>" + new String(head));
        }

        // Check for WAV, AU, and AIFF, Ogg Vorbis, Flac, MAC file formats.
        // Next check for Shoutcast (supported) and OGG (unsupported) streams.
        if ((head[0] == 'R') && (head[1] == 'I') && (head[2] == 'F') && (head[3] == 'F') && (head[8] == 'W') && (head[9] == 'A') && (head[10] == 'V') && (head[11] == 'E'))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("RIFF/WAV stream found");
            int isPCM = ((head[21]<<8)&0x0000FF00) | ((head[20])&0x00000FF);
            if (weak == null)
            {
                if (isPCM == 1)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("WAV PCM stream found");
            }

        }
        else if ((head[0] == '.') && (head[1] == 's') && (head[2] == 'n') && (head[3] == 'd'))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("AU stream found");
            if (weak == null)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("AU stream found");
        }
        else if ((head[0] == 'F') && (head[1] == 'O') && (head[2] == 'R') && (head[3] == 'M') && (head[8] == 'A') && (head[9] == 'I') && (head[10] == 'F') && (head[11] == 'F'))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("AIFF stream found");
            if (weak == null)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("AIFF stream found");
        }
        else if (((head[0] == 'M') | (head[0] == 'm')) && ((head[1] == 'A') | (head[1] == 'a')) && ((head[2] == 'C') | (head[2] == 'c')))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("APE stream found");
            if (weak == null)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("APE stream found");
        }
        else if (((head[0] == 'F') | (head[0] == 'f')) && ((head[1] == 'L') | (head[1] == 'l')) && ((head[2] == 'A') | (head[2] == 'a')) && ((head[3] == 'C') | (head[3] == 'c')))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("FLAC stream found");
            if (weak == null)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("FLAC stream found");
        }
        // Shoutcast stream ?
        else if (((head[0] == 'I') | (head[0] == 'i')) && ((head[1] == 'C') | (head[1] == 'c')) && ((head[2] == 'Y') | (head[2] == 'y')))
        {
            pis.unread(head);
            // Load shoutcast meta data.
            loadShoutcastInfo(pis, aff_properties);
        }
        // Ogg stream ?
        else if (((head[0] == 'O') | (head[0] == 'o')) && ((head[1] == 'G') | (head[1] == 'g')) && ((head[2] == 'G') | (head[2] == 'g')))
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Ogg stream found");
            if (weak == null)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("Ogg stream found");
        }
        // No, so pushback.
        else
        {
            pis.unread(head);
        }
        // MPEG header info.
        int nVersion =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nLayer =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nSFIndex =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nMode =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int FrameSize =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nFrameSize =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nFrequency =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nTotalFrames =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        float FrameRate =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int BitRate =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nChannels =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nHeader =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        int nTotalMS = A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ED;
        boolean nVBR = false;
        AudioFormat.Encoding encoding = null;
        try
        {
            Bitstream m_bitstream = new Bitstream(pis);
            int streamPos = m_bitstream.header_pos();
            aff_properties.put("mp3.header.pos", new Integer(streamPos));
            Header m_header = m_bitstream.readFrame();
            // nVersion = 0 => MPEG2-LSF (Including MPEG2.5), nVersion = 1 => MPEG1
            nVersion = m_header.version();
            if (nVersion == 2) aff_properties.put("mp3.version.mpeg", Float.toString(2.5f));
            else aff_properties.put("mp3.version.mpeg", Integer.toString(2 - nVersion));
            // nLayer = 1,2,3
            nLayer = m_header.layer();
            aff_properties.put("mp3.version.layer", Integer.toString(nLayer));
            nSFIndex = m_header.sample_frequency();
            nMode = m_header.mode();
            aff_properties.put("mp3.mode", new Integer(nMode));
            nChannels = nMode == 3 ? 1 : 2;
            aff_properties.put("mp3.channels", new Integer(nChannels));
            nVBR = m_header.vbr();
            af_properties.put("vbr", new Boolean(nVBR));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.vbr", new Boolean(nVBR));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.vbr.scale", new Integer(m_header.vbr_scale()));
            FrameSize = m_header.calculate_framesize();
            aff_properties.put("mp3.framesize.bytes", new Integer(FrameSize));
            if (FrameSize < 0)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("Invalid FrameSize : " + FrameSize);
            nFrequency = m_header.frequency();
            aff_properties.put("mp3.frequency.hz", new Integer(nFrequency));
            FrameRate = (float) ((1.0 / (m_header.ms_per_frame())) * 1000.0);
            aff_properties.put("mp3.framerate.fps", new Float(FrameRate));
            if (FrameRate < 0) thro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("Invalid FrameRate : " + FrameRate);
            // Remove heading tag length from real stream length.
            int tmpLength = mLength;
            if ((streamPos > 0) && (mLength != A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ED) && (streamPos < mLength)) tmpLength = tmpLength - streamPos;
            if (mLength != A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ED)
            {
                aff_properties.put("mp3.length.bytes", new Integer(mLength));
                nTotalFrames = m_header.max_number_of_frames(tmpLength);
                aff_properties.put("mp3.length.frames", new Integer(nTotalFrames));
            }
            BitRate = m_header.bitrate();
            af_properties.put("bitrate", new Integer(BitRate));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.bitrate.nominal.bps", new Integer(BitRate));
            nHeader = m_header.getSyncHeader();
            encoding = sm_aEncodings[nVersion][nLayer - 1];
            aff_properties.put("mp3.version.encoding", encoding.toString());
            if (mLength != A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ED)
            {
                nTotalMS = Math.round(m_header.total_ms(tmpLength));
                aff_properties.put("duration", new Long((long) nTotalMS * 1000L));
            }
            aff_properties.put("mp3.copyright", new Boolean(m_header.copyright()));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.original", new Boolean(m_header.original()));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.crc", new Boolean(m_header.checksums()));
            aff_properties.put("mp3.padding", new Boolean(m_header.padding()));
            InputStream id3v2 = m_bitstream.getRawID3v2();
            if (id3v2 != null)
            {
                aff_properties.put("mp3.id3tag.v2", id3v2);
                parseID3v2Frames(id3v2, aff_properties);
            }
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out(m_header.toString());
        }
        catch (Exception e)
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("not a MPEG stream:" + e.getMessage());
            thro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("not a MPEG stream:" + e.getMessage());
        }
        // Deeper checks ?
        int cVersion = (nHeader >> 19) & 0x3;
        if (cVersion == 1)
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("not a MPEG stream: wrong version");
            thro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("not a MPEG stream: wrong version");
        }
        int cSFIndex = (nHeader >> 10) & 0x3;
        if (cSFIndex == 3)
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("not a MPEG stream: wrong sampling rate");
            throw new UnsupportedAudioFileException("not a MPEG stream: wrong sampling rate");
        }
        // Look up for ID3v1 tag
        if ((size == mediaLength) && (mediaLength != A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ED))
        {
            FileInputStream fis = (FileInputStream) inputStream;
            byte[] id3v1 = new byte[128];
            long bytesSkipped = fis.skip(inputStream.available() - id3v1.length);
            int read = fis.read(id3v1, 0, id3v1.length);
            if ((id3v1[0] == 'T') && (id3v1[1] == 'A') && (id3v1[2] == 'G'))
            {
                parseID3v1Frames(id3v1, aff_properties);
            }
        }
        AudioFormat format = new MpegAudioFormat(encoding, (float) nFrequency, AudioSystem.NOT_SPECIFIED // SampleSizeInBits - The size of a sample
                , nChannels // Channels - The number of channels
                , -1 // The number of bytes in each frame
                , FrameRate // FrameRate - The number of frames played or recorded per second
                , true, af_properties);
        return new MpegAudioFileFormat(MpegFileFormatType.MP3, format, nTotalFrames, mLength, aff_properties);
    }

    /**
     * Parser ID3v1 frames
     * @param frames
     * @param props
     */
    protected void parseID3v1Frames(byte[] frames, HashMap props)
    {
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Parsing ID3v1");
        String tag = null;
        try
        {
            tag = new String(frames, 0, frames.length, "ISO-8859-1");
        }
        catch (UnsupportedEncodingException e)
        {
            tag = new String(frames, 0, frames.length);
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Cannot use ISO-8859-1");
        }
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("ID3v1 frame dump='" + tag + "'");
        int start = 3;
        String titlev1 = chopSubstring(tag, start, start += 30);
        String titlev2 = (String) props.get("title");
        if (((titlev2 == null) || (titlev2.length() == 0)) && (titlev1 != null)) props.put("title", titlev1);
        String artistv1 = chopSubstring(tag, start, start += 30);
        String artistv2 = (String) props.get("author");
        if (((artistv2 == null) || (artistv2.length() == 0)) && (artistv1 != null)) props.put("author", artistv1);
        String albumv1 = chopSubstring(tag, start, start += 30);
        String albumv2 = (String) props.get("album");
        if (((albumv2 == null) || (albumv2.length() == 0)) && (albumv1 != null)) props.put("album", albumv1);
        String yearv1 = chopSubstring(tag, start, start += 4);
        String yearv2 = (String) props.get("year");
        if (((yearv2 == null) || (yearv2.length() == 0)) && (yearv1 != null)) props.put("date", yearv1);
        String commentv1 = chopSubstring(tag, start, start += 28);
        String commentv2 = (String) props.get("comment");
        if (((commentv2 == null) || (commentv2.length() == 0)) && (commentv1 != null)) props.put("comment", commentv1);
        String trackv1 = "" + ((int) (frames[126] & 0xff));
        String trackv2 = (String) props.get("mp3.id3tag.track");
        if (((trackv2 == null) || (trackv2.length() == 0)) && (trackv1 != null)) props.put("mp3.id3tag.track", trackv1);
        int genrev1 = (int) (frames[127] & 0xff);
        if ((genrev1 >= 0) && (genrev1 < id3v1genres.length))
        {
            String genrev2 = (String) props.get("mp3.id3tag.genre");
            if (((genrev2 == null) || (genrev2.length() == 0))) props.put("mp3.id3tag.genre", id3v1genres[genrev1]);
        }
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("ID3v1 parsed");
    }

    /**
     * Parse ID3v2 frames to add album (TALB), title (TIT2), date (TYER), author (TPE1), copyright (TCOP), comment (COMM) ...
     * @param frames
     * @param props
     */
    protected void parseID3v2Frames(InputStream frames, HashMap props)
    {
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Parsing ID3v2");
        byte[] bframes = null;
        int size = -1;
        try
        {
            size = frames.available();
            bframes = new byte[size];
            frames.mark(size);
            frames.read(bframes);
            frames.reset();
        }
        catch (IOException e)
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Cannot parse ID3v2 :" + e.getMessage());
        }
        if (!"ID3".equals(new String(bframes, 0, 3)))
        {
            TDebug.out("No ID3v2 header found!");
            return;
        }
        int v2version = (int) (bframes[3] & 0xFF);
        props.put("mp3.id3tag.v2.version", String.valueOf(v2version));
        if (v2version < 2 || v2version > 4)
        {
            TDebug.out("Unsupported ID3v2 version " + v2version + "!");
            return;
        }
        try
        {
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("ID3v2 frame dump='" + new String(bframes, 0, bframes.length) + "'");
            /* ID3 tags : http://www.unixgods.org/~tilo/ID3/docs/ID3_comparison.html */
            String value = null;
            for (int i = 10; i < bframes.length && bframes[i] > 0; i += size)
            {
                if (v2version == 3 || v2version == 4)
                {
                    // ID3v2.3 & ID3v2.4
                    String code = new String(bframes, i, 4);
                    size = (int) ((bframes[i + 4] << 24) & 0xFF000000 | (bframes[i + 5] << 16) & 0x00FF0000 | (bframes[i + 6] << 8) & 0x0000FF00 | (bframes[i + 7]) & 0x000000FF);
                    i += 10;
                    if ((code.equals("TALB")) || (code.equals("TIT2")) || (code.equals("TYER")) ||
                        (code.equals("TPE1")) || (code.equals("TCOP")) || (code.equals("COMM")) ||
                        (code.equals("TCON")) || (code.equals("TRCK")) || (code.equals("TPOS")) ||
                        (code.equals("TDRC")) || (code.equals("TCOM")) || (code.equals("TIT1")) ||
                        (code.equals("TENC")) || (code.equals("TPUB")) || (code.equals("TPE2")) ||
                        (code.equals("TLEN")) )
                    {
                        if (code.equals("COMM")) value = parseText(bframes, i, size, 5);
                        else value = parseText(bframes, i, size, 1);
                        if ((value != null) && (value.length() > 0))
                        {
                            if (code.equals("TALB")) props.put("album",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TIT2")) props.put("title",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TYER")) props.put("date", value);
                            // ID3v2.4 date fix.
                            else if (code.equals("TDRC")) props.put("date",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TPE1")) props.put("author",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TCOP")) props.put("copyright", value);
                            else if (code.equals("COMM")) props.put("comment",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TCON")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.genre",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TRCK")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.track",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TPOS")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.disc",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TCOM")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.composer",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TIT1")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.grouping",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TENC")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.encoded",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TPUB")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.publisher",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TPE2")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.orchestra", value);
                            else if (code.equals("TLEN")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.length", value);
                        }
                    }
                }
                else
                {
                    // ID3v2.2
                    String scode = new String(bframes, i, 3);
                    size = (int) (0x00000000) + (bframes[i + 3] << 16) + (bframes[i + 4] << 8) + (bframes[i + 5]);
                    i += 6;
                    if ((scode.equals("TAL")) || (scode.equals("TT2")) || (scode.equals("TP1")) ||
                        (scode.equals("TYE")) || (scode.equals("TRK")) || (scode.equals("TPA")) ||
                        (scode.equals("TCR")) || (scode.equals("TCO")) || (scode.equals("TCM")) ||
                        (scode.equals("COM")) || (scode.equals("TT1")) || (scode.equals("TEN")) ||
                        (scode.equals("TPB")) || (scode.equals("TP2")) || (scode.equals("TLE")) )
                    {
                        if (scode.equals("COM")) value = parseText(bframes, i, size, 5);
                        else value = parseText(bframes, i, size, 1);
                        if ((value != null) && (value.length() > 0))
                        {
                            if (scode.equals("TAL")) props.put("album",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TT2")) props.put("title",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TYE")) props.put("date",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TP1")) props.put("author",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TCR")) props.put("copyright",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("COM")) props.put("comment",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TCO")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.genre",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TRK")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.track",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TPA")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.disc",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TCM")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.composer",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TT1")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.grouping",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TEN")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.encoded",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TPB")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.publisher",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TP2")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.orchestra", value);
                            else if (scode.equals("TLE")) props.put("mp3.id3tag.length", value);
                        }
                    }
                }
            }
        }
        catch (RuntimeException e)
        {
            // Ignore all parsing errors.
            if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("Cannot parse ID3v2 :" + e.getMessage());
        }
        if (TDebug.TraceAudioFileReader) TDebug.out("ID3v2 parsed");
    }
